Walk
18-year-old Noah (Asha Banks) is moving from Florida to London with her mother to live with her rich new stepfather, William (Ray Fearon), and his son Nick (Matthew Broome. She meets Nick, and the two of them immediately dislike one another and agree to stay away from each other. Noah was in a long-distance relationship with her boyfriend Dan, who was still in Florida. The family attend an event where Noah learns that Nick has also made his own money through a ride sharing app and isn't as spoiled as she thinks. Nick sold the business when he was 17. Nick then takes Noah home but leaves her on the pavement after an argument involving his mother. Nick then sends his valet Zach (Sekou Diaby) to pick her up, but Zach instead takes her to the party Nick is at. Noah watches him dance with multiple girls and throws a drink at him, irritating him. However, she is drugged from a spiked drink that she accepted, and Nick saves her, before punching the guy who did it. As he takes her home, he notices a figure eight knot tattoo that she has. Nick continues to hang out with a girl named Anna (Amelia Kenworthy). One day, Noah receives a picture showing Haley (Tallulah Evans), her best friend, and Dan (Harry Gilby), her boyfriend, kissing. Upset, she makes Nick take her to a car racing event that he is attending. She meets Jenna (Enva Lewis) and displays her own car knowledge, which is extensive due to her dad having taught her how to drive. Noah says that her father is in prison now. She also meets Lion (Kerim Hassan), Nick's best friend and Jenna's boyfriend. Nick finds out about the picture and offers to kiss her and picture it so that they send it to Dan for revenge. They kiss, and Noah finds out about how Nick fights and races. Nick is meant to race with Ronnie (Sam Buchanan), a dangerous man, as a bet but Noah gets into the car instead. She wins, despite Ronnie trying to sabotage her, but because Nick didn't race, the bet is void, meaning Nick will have to fight Ronnie. The latter promptly insults Noah as she attempts to defend Nick, leading Nick to push him, and an aggressive fight begins. Noah has a panic attack triggered by the violence, courtesy of her father directly his anger towards her. At home, Noah apologizes and talks about how she gets panic attacks due to the dark as well as small spaces. They nearly kiss again, and the next day Nick takes her to see Maddie. Noah finds out that Maddie is his sister, and that his mother Bethan (Christina Cole) is a recovered alcoholic who left Nick and William to get better. Nick is allowed to see Maddie as long as he avoids violence. Noah also finds out that Anna isn't Nick's girlfriend, and later the two kiss. Once back home, Ella surprises Noah by inviting Dan to London, not knowing about him cheating on Noah with Haley. Dan recognizes Nick from the photos and tries to win Noah back but Noah refuses and makes out with Nick again. Noah tells Nick to make Dan leave the house as soon as possible. Nick ends up paying Dan off to go back home. However, Nick punches him before leaving, saying he would've paid even more but Dan is cheap. Noah and Nick spend more time together, but Nick attends a fight with Ronnie. Noah leaves the fight, upset as Nick had promised Bethan that he would avoid violence, and Nick notices and leaves, causing Ronnie to threaten him and take his car. One day, Ronnie attacks their car at a petrol station, and they narrowly escape. Nick feels that there is something else, other than professional rivalry, that is fueling Ronnie's attacks on him, but he cannot figure it out. Noah and Nick, along with Jenna and Lion, fly to Ibiza for Nick's birthday. There, at a bar, when a man does not leave Noah alone, Nick punches him causing Noah to get angry. After telling him that he represents everything she has tried to escape, she storms off and the two stop speaking. Back in London, at Anna's party, she and her friends lock Noah up in a cupboard when she wanted to go to the bathroom, Anna being angry about Nick spending time with Noah. Due to her traumatic past with her father who tried to kill her, Noah begins to have a panic attack and has flashbacks. Nick finds her and comforts her. Back at the mansion, Noah talks to Nick about her past, and they have sex. Lion gets attacked violently by Ronnie. Nick thinks it's about him not fighting with Ronnie, but his dad brings in a detective Sato (Fiona Marr), and they find out that the smashing of the car and the beating up of Lion is part of a bigger plan from Noah's dad. Ronnie is working with Noah's dad Travis (Jason Flemyng), who is out of jail, to find her again. Ronnie and Noah's father were cell mates in prison and Ronnie was working on his instructions. Ronnie and Noah's dad kidnap her. They call Noah's family demanding a ransom of a million dollars. Nick, increasingly worried, realizes that because Ronnie has his car, he can find Noah by tracking the car's GPS. Nick arrives and fights with Ronnie but ends up getting stabbed before being able to knock him out. Noah is forced to drive away from him at gunpoint by her father, and despite being wounded, Nick follows her. A car chase scene occurs, and eventually Nick causes a car crash to force their car to stop, injuring him further. The police arrive as Noah's dad holds her at gunpoint, but Noah manages to escape and comforts a collapsing Nick, who falls unconscious. 6 weeks later, both Nick and Noah have recovered from their injuries and are happy together. William and Ella momentarily think about whether Noah and Nick might be in a romantic relationship but dismiss it. Noah and Nick kiss underwater.
